Book Overview
F.E. Penny\'s On the Coromandel Coast, published in 1908, offers a glimpse into the lives and times of those living on the Coromandel Coast of India, particularly during the British colonial era. The book, reconstructed using digital technology to preserve the original format, provides insights into the historical backdrop, the challenges of adapting to a new environment, and the social dynamics of the time.
TOC
Key Themes
Arrival of Europeans: The book explores the arrival of Europeans, specifically the English, on the Coromandel Coast and the establishment of Madras. It notes the ships of the era were about 300 tons burden and the travelers faced dangers such as weather, pirates, and diseases from bacteria in the water. Life of the Fisher-Folk: The book describes the lives of the local Fisher-Folk, highlighting their crucial role in the early days of European trade and settlement. Hardships and Famine: It explores the impact of devastating famines on the local inhabitants, contrasting their plight with the relative prosperity of the English trading colony. Caste System: The book delves into the complex social structure of India, particularly the enduring power of the caste system, and its effect on both Europeans and Indians. Establishment of English Presence: It showcases how the English community established its presence in Madras, including the founding of St. George\'s Cathedral and the construction of grand buildings and well-maintained avenues.
Importance of Book
Historical Record: The book serves as a historical record of life on the Coromandel Coast during a critical period of British colonial expansion, documenting the challenges faced by early European settlers and the social dynamics of the time. Cultural Insights: It offers insights into the culture, customs, and social dynamics of the region, shedding light on the interactions between the British and the local population. Preservation of History: As a digitally reconstructed historical work, the book preserves the original format and makes it accessible to modern readers, ensuring that the history of the Coromandel Coast is not forgotten.
Cultural Significance
Colonialism and Cultural Exchange: The book reflects the cultural interactions and exchanges between the British and the local population during the colonial era, providing a glimpse into the complexities of these relationships. Social Structures: It provides insights into the rigid social structures of India, particularly the caste system, and how it impacted the lives of both Europeans and Indians. Religious and Architectural Influences: The establishment of St. George\'s Cathedral showcases the introduction of European religious and architectural influences on the Coromandel Coast.
Effects on Society
Understanding Colonial History: The book contributes to a better understanding of the history of British colonialism in India, providing valuable insights into the challenges and complexities of this period. Appreciation for Cultural Heritage: By documenting and preserving the history and culture of the Coromandel Coast, the book promotes an appreciation for the region\'s rich heritage. Educational Resource: The book serves as an educational resource for students, scholars, and anyone interested in learning about the history, culture, and social dynamics of the Coromandel Coast during the British colonial era.
Conclusion
On the Coromandel Coast by F. E. Penny is a valuable historical and cultural resource that offers insights into life on the Coromandel Coast during the British colonial era. It explores the challenges faced by early European settlers, the social dynamics of the time, and the impact of colonialism on the region. The book\'s cultural significance lies in its portrayal of the interactions between the British and the local population, the rigid social structures of India, and the introduction of European influences on the Coromandel Coast.
